Output 08dbc51bb84a9a23aff31a1e81a4d1ca557592f7258a4a2e350c4f0fb269ded0:0

value
117249
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ae58696198069d972e629f0eb75eeeac4626cc08 OP_EQUAL
address
3HasQsUWZdd1Ci5qh6hcmUr2vctLuiMrsQ
transaction
08dbc51bb84a9a23aff31a1e81a4d1ca557592f7258a4a2e350c4f0fb269ded0
spent
true